С удовольствием предоставлю подробный ответ на данный вопрос.
Вопрос: Предусловие цикла. Заполните пропуски в тексте.
Ответ:
1. В цикле с предусловием.
2. Ложным.
3. Перед выполнением тела цикла.
4. После каждого выполнения тела цикла перед проверкой условия.
Пояснение:
Циклы в программировании используются для многократного выполнения определенных действий. Они состоят из условия и тела цикла, которое будет выполняться, пока условие истинно (для цикла с предусловием) или после выполнения тела цикла (для цикла с постусловием).
1. В цикле с предусловием (цикл-пока), условие проверяется перед каждым выполнением тела цикла. Если условие истинно, то тело цикла будет выполняться, а если условие ложно, то цикл будет прерван и выполнение программы продолжится после цикла.
2. Условие в цикле с предусловием должно быть истинным, чтобы цикл начал свое выполнение. Если условие изначально ложно, то цикл не будет выполняться, а сразу перейдет к следующей части программы.
3. Цикл с постусловием (цикл do-while) отличается от цикла с предусловием тем, что условие проверяется после выполнения тела цикла. Это означает, что тело цикла будет выполнено, хотя бы один раз, даже если условие изначально ложно.
4. В цикле с постусловием (цикл do-while), после каждого выполнения тела цикла, условие проверяется перед следующим выполнением тела цикла. Если условие истинно, то цикл продолжит свое выполнение, а если условие ложно, то цикл завершится и выполнение программы продолжится после цикла.
Таким образом, предусловие цикла относится к возможности цикла начать свое выполнение на основе истинности условия, а постусловие цикла относится к условию проверки после каждого выполнения тела цикла и возможности повторного выполнения цикла на основе истинности этого условия.